Release, runtime and language
1985 · 145 mins · Tamil
Directed by
S. P. Muthuraman
Starring
Radha Ravi, Kamal Haasan, Ambika, Kovai Sarala, Y. G. Mahendran, Janagaraj

Anand, a spoiled heir who inherited a fortune after his parents' death, wastes his days drinking and gambling. After a nighttime brawl with thugs, he is rescued by Selvam, who beats up the attackers and brings Anand home. The next morning he has no memory, but Mani and accountant Nagapillai help Selvam, and Anand hires him as assistant.

Uyarndha Ullam Characters Explained: Who Is Who

The main characters of Uyarndha Ullam (1985), heroes and villains: what drives them, how they change over the course of the story and what each of them reveals about the film's bigger ideas.

  • Anand (Kamal Haasan)

    A spoilt heir who squanders his inheritance but gradually learns responsibility through Geetha's care and personal hardship. His arc moves from self-indulgence to humility as he confronts debt, betrayal, and illness, eventually choosing a simpler life with love. He is capable of generosity and courage, even after his faith in people is shaken.

  • Geetha (Ambika)

    Geetha is hired to restore order in Anand's disordered life and becomes the emotional anchor of the story. She helps Anand quit drinking and supports him through financial ruin and personal loss. Her steadfast care evolves into a deeper bond, guiding him toward a healthier, more compassionate path.

  • Selvam

    A mysterious rescuer who saves Anand from a brawl and later manipulates events with a past lover to ensure Anand's downfall. His actions reveal a pragmatic, if morally ambiguous, approach to achieving his ends. Ultimately, he confronts the consequences of his deception as circumstances unfold.

  • Nagapillai

    Anand's accountant who warns of mounting debts and helps navigate the financial crisis. His involvement marks the shift from personal to institutional pressures as the mansion is prepared for sale. His death becomes a turning point that deepens Anand's despair and resolve.

Uyarndha Ullam Meaning: Themes & Message Explained

What is Uyarndha Ullam (1985) really about? The emotional, social and philosophical themes the film keeps returning to, its symbolism and the message beneath the surface.

  • Wealth & Downfall

    The story tracks how wealth initially shapes friendships and decisions, often enabling reckless living. As money dries up, true loyalties surface and the hollowness of status is revealed. Anand's arc shows wealth as a test rather than a shield, prompting a moral reset. The theme underscores that riches cannot buy real happiness or integrity.

  • Betrayal

    Selvam's manipulation of Anand through a staged romance exposes how trust can be exploited. The revelation at the wedding exposes the scam and tests Anand's faith in people. The betrayal contrasts with Geetha's honesty and steadfast care. It drives the emotional tension and forces characters to reevaluate their values.

  • Love & Healing

    Geetha's unwavering support helps Anand conquer his addiction and rediscover purpose. The evolving relationship between them anchors the transformation from self-indulgence to responsibility. Love becomes a catalyst for healing and a catalyst for a simpler, happier life. The bond demonstrates how compassion can restore dignity and hope.

  • Appearance vs Reality

    The film continually juxtaposes outward wealth with inner virtue. Deceptive schemes and social facades contrast with genuine care and sacrifice. The public exposure of Selvam's scam reveals the difference between image and truth. The narrative uses these contrasts to question what truly constitutes success.
